The star-effect may be also caused by the inclusions of hematite. In black star sapphire hematite needles formed parallel to the faces of the second order prism produce asterism. Some star sapphires from Thailand contain both hematite and rutile needles forming a 12-ray star. [3] Star-stones were formerly regarded with much superstition. [1]

A star sapphire is a type of sapphire that exhibits a star-like phenomenon known as asterism; red stones are known as "star rubies". Star sapphires contain intersecting needle-like inclusions following the underlying crystal structure that causes the appearance of a six-rayed "star"-shaped pattern when viewed with a single overhead light source.
